What caused widespread hunger and misery in Germany in 1918?

Explanation:
The widespread hunger and misery in Germany in 1918 can be primarily attributed to the British naval blockade, which was implemented to cut off supplies to Germany during World War I. This blockade severely limited Germany's ability to import food and essential goods, leading to significant shortages across the country. The blockade was a strategic measure designed to weaken Germany economically and militarily, and its effects were felt particularly acutely by the civilian population. As a result, food became scarce, prices soared, and malnutrition was rampant, contributing to social unrest and dissatisfaction among the German populace. While other factors were at play during this time, such as the ongoing war effort and poor agricultural yields, the blockade was the decisive cause for the acute food crisis. Military victories, if achieved, did not translate into better living conditions for the civilians who were grappling with the consequences of shortages caused by the blockade. Increased agricultural production was not a reality due to the devastation of the war and the depletion of resources. Moreover, trade agreements with neighboring countries were significantly hampered by the war and the blockade itself, further exacerbating the food crisis in Germany.

Exam Format: What You Need to Know

The iGCSE History exam focuses on Germany from 1918 to 1945 and consists of multiple sections, each encompassing different types of questions. Understanding the format is crucial in tailoring your study strategy to succeed:

  • Duration: The total time allotted for the iGCSE History examination is typically 2 hours.

  • Types of Questions:

  • Source-Based Questions: These questions assess your ability to interpret and analyze historical sources. Expect to extract information and demonstrate reasoning based on sources provided.

  • Structured Questions: These involve short to extended-response questions requiring you to formulate clear, concise answers based on your historical understanding.

  • Marks Allocation: The exam generally comprises marks awarded across various question types, so managing time effectively during the exam is critical.

What to Expect on the Exam

The exam is structured to test your knowledge on a comprehensive array of historical periods and incidents. Key topics include:

  1. Weimar Republic (1919-1933): Analyze the challenges faced by Germany post-World War I, the establishment of the Weimar Republic, and its eventual downfall.
  2. Nazi Germany (1933-1945): Examine the rise of Adolf Hitler, the establishment of Nazi regime policies, and the implications of World War II on Germany.
  3. Impact of World War II: Study Germany's role in World War II, including key battles, military strategies, and the eventual downfall of the Nazi regime.

It's pivotal to understand these periods in-depth, as they form the core of several questions in the exam.
